Cognition and Decision Making in Complex Adaptive Systems: The Human Factor in Organizational Performance

This book explains the role of human behavior research, from both a historical and modern perspective, in improving objective, measurable performance outcomes to include safety, strategic decision making, and organizational performance. Meghan Carmody-Bubb graduated from Texas A&M University with a B.S. in Psychology in 1986 and received her Ph.D. in Experimental Psychology from Texas Tech University in 1993. Upon completing coursework, she was commissioned in the U.S. Navy, where she graduated from the training program in Aerospace Experimental Psychology at the Naval Aerospace Medical Institute.
